South Stanly men’s basketball opens with win
The South Stanly men’s basketball squad opened Friday night with a 60-53 home non-conference win over the Mount Pleasant Tigers.
Justin Gaddy led South with 22 points including 4-of-4 from the free-throw line in the fourth quarter.
Jaquez Cooke added 17 points, 12 coming in the second half for the Bulls.
Hunter Sloop led Mount Pleasant (0-1) with 22 points while Brady Duke added 10 points.
South Stanly travels Monday night to Southwestern Randolph and returns home to host Montgomery Central Dec. 4.
